#403734 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#403734 is composed of 25.1% red, 21.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.1% magenta, 18.8%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 15 degrees, a saturation of 10.3% and a lightness of 22.7%. #403734 color hex could be obtained by blending #806e68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#403734 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#403734 has RGB values of R:64, G:55,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.19,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4208436.

Shades and Tints of #403734
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0808 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#403734
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3938 is the less saturated color, while #711e03 is the most saturated one.
